❌ Common Mistakes to Avoid
• Letting the oil get too hot: Frying the egg rolls at a temperature that’s too high can result in a burnt exterior and an undercooked interior. Maintain the oil temperature at 350°F for best results.
• Overcrowding the pan: Fry the egg rolls in batches to avoid lowering the oil temperature and ensure even cooking.
• Not sealing the wrappers properly: Ensure that the edges are tightly sealed to prevent the filling from leaking out during frying.
• Skipping the draining step: Allowing the fried egg rolls to drain on a paper towel-lined plate helps remove excess oil and maintain a crisp texture.
🧊 Storing Tips for the Recipe
These Cherry Cheesecake Egg Rolls retain their quality remarkably well:
• Freezing unbaked: Prepare the egg rolls up to the point of frying, then freeze them in a single layer on a baking sheet. Once frozen, transfer them to an airtight container or resealable bag and freeze for up to 3 months. Fry the frozen egg rolls directly from the freezer, adding 1-2 minutes to the cooking time.
• Freezing baked: Allow the fried egg rolls to cool completely, then wrap them individually in plastic wrap or foil. Place the wrapped egg rolls in an airtight container or resealable bag and freeze for up to 2 months. To reheat, bake the frozen egg rolls at 350°F for 10-12 minutes, or until heated through and crisp.
• Reheating: For the best texture, reheat the egg rolls in a 350°F oven for 5-7 minutes, or until warmed through. Avoid microwaving, as it can make the wrappers soggy.

Can I substitute the cream cheese with a different type of cheese?
While cream cheese is the traditional choice for this recipe, you can experiment with other soft, spreadable cheeses as well. Ricotta, mascarpone, or even a blend of cream cheese and cottage cheese can work well, though the flavor profile may be slightly different.

What can I do if the egg rolls start to leak or burst during frying?
If you encounter any leakage or bursting during frying, it’s likely due to overfilling the wrappers or not sealing them properly. To prevent this, be sure to use the recommended amount of filling and take the time to tightly seal the edges of the wrappers before frying.
